Job Title: Enterprise Database Architect
Job Type: Contract

Department: [IT / Data Management / Architecture]

Reports to: [Chief Data Officer / Director of IT / CTO]

Job Summary:

We are seeking an experienced Enterprise Database Architect to lead the design, implementation, and management of our organization's enterprise-wide data architecture. This role is responsible for ensuring data solutions align with business needs, are scalable, secure, and support decision-making and digital transformation efforts.

Key Responsibilities:

Design and maintain the enterprise database architecture strategy in alignment with business objectives.

Develop models and standards for database structures, access, and governance.

Lead the selection and implementation of database technologies (relational, NoSQL, cloud databases, etc.).

Evaluate and optimize database performance, security, and scalability across platforms.

Collaborate with data engineers, developers, analysts, and stakeholders to deliver high-quality data solutions.

Ensure data integrity, quality, and availability across all systems and platforms.

Establish policies and procedures for database development and usage.

Provide guidance on data migration, data warehousing, and cloud integration.

Conduct regular system audits and implement best practices in database management and security.

Mentor team members and provide architectural oversight for large-scale data initiatives.

Required Qualifications:

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.

8+ years of experience in database architecture, design, and development.

Strong knowledge of relational (e.g., Oracle, SQL Server, PostgreSQL) and non-relational (e.g., MongoDB, Cassandra) databases.

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and cloud-native database services.

Deep understanding of data modeling, normalization, and data warehousing concepts.

Proficiency in SQL and scripting languages (e.g., Python, Shell).

Strong knowledge of database security, backup and recovery, high availability, and disaster recovery strategies.

Familiarity with data governance and compliance frameworks (e.g., GDPR, HIPAA).

Preferred Qualifications:

Certifications such as AWS Certified Database – Specialty, Microsoft Certified: Azure Database Administrator Associate, or equivalent.

Experience with enterprise data lake and big data platforms (e.g., Hadoop, Spark).

Strong project management and stakeholder communication skills.
